Terminals - Barrel, Bullet Connectors

1. Overview

Barrel and Bullet connectors are cylindrical electrical connectors primarily used for power transmission and signal routing. Barrel connectors typically feature a concentric conducting surface separated by insulation, while Bullet connectors use a single-pin design with high-conductivity materials. These connectors play critical roles in consumer electronics, industrial equipment, and automotive systems due to their reliability and compact design.

3. Structure and Composition

Barrel connectors typically consist of three main components: 1) Center contact pin (phosphor bronze with gold plating), 2) Insulating dielectric (polyamide or PBT), 3) Outer conductive sleeve (nickel-plated brass). Bullet connectors feature a precision-machined single contact element with spring-loaded retention mechanisms. Both types utilize thermoplastic housings for strain relief and environmental protection.

7. Selection Recommendations

Key considerations include: 1) Current requirements (use 20% derating factor), 2) Environmental conditions (temperature range, IP rating), 3) Mechanical constraints (space limitations, mating force). For medical applications, specify Agilent-grade insulation materials. For outdoor EV charging stations, prioritize IP67-rated waterproof designs. Always verify compatibility with cable gauge specifications.
